A lot cheaper to call for a tow vs. engine replacement.
Also for the other poster, regardless if your car has two or three radiators they still share the same coolant and if you bust a line or crack a tank you will drain the system of coolant, the other(s) will not compensate as a redundant system.
Also with a engine running at 190ish degrees it really does not matter much with outside temp.
Hope nothing was warped as it does not take long with no coolant.
